The Blood of Dawnwalker

Skills Guide: Progression

Quick Answer

Coen has three connected paths: Swordmastery works at any time, Witchcraft is daytime-only, and Vampirism is night-only. They share XP and skill points, but manuals, time, corruption, and health create different unlock costs.

Three paths, one progression economy

The Blood of Dawnwalker does not split daytime and nighttime experience into separate pools. Defeating enemies, completing objectives, discovering hidden places, and overcoming special encounters award experience. Level gains provide skill points, and Bandai Namco confirms that the same points can be assigned to any of the three trees.

The trees still have different access rules. Swordmastery is available in both forms. Witchcraft belongs to human Coen during the day, while Vampirism awakens at night. A point spent in one tree is therefore not just a damage choice; it changes which half of the day can use that investment.

Swordmastery is the universal foundation

Swordmastery emphasizes timing, positioning, defensive resilience, counters, mobility, and offensive combinations. Because it works around the clock, it is the safest foundation for a first build. The official combat explanation supports both assisted omniattacks and omniblocks and a more manual directional style, so progression can support different control preferences rather than one required technique.

New sword techniques are not granted by level alone. Manuals left by soldiers or bandits, and manuals sold by fencers encountered in the world, open or improve Swordmastery abilities. Books are therefore meaningful exploration rewards. Different short, long, and great swords alter attack speed, while axes and other weapons can also appear, so match perks to the weapons you actually use.

Witchcraft controls the daytime battlefield

Anca teaches Coen witchcraft. Official notes describe offensive and defensive spells, crowd control, damage over time, buffs, and debuffs. This makes the tree suited to setting up an encounter, weakening a group, or changing the terms of a fight before relying on the sword.

Witchcraft manuals are associated with ancient ruins, haunted locations, and magic practitioners. Method's launch guide reports that these skills are unavailable at night because Coen's transformed body heals over the runes used for magic. Treat that explanation as specialist guide detail; the stable planning point is that a witchcraft-heavy investment needs a capable night fallback.

Vampirism trades safety for power

Vampiric abilities are tied to night, feeding, and corruption. Increasing corruption unlocks access to stronger powers, while abilities may demand health or another sacrifice. This is not simply a second spell list: progression is connected to how often Coen embraces his curse and to the consequences of feeding.

Method reports that Vampirism includes claw-focused play and ultimates built around survival, kills, and feeding. Exact balance can change with patches, so choose the tree for its resource loop rather than treating one launch-week ability as permanently dominant. Maintain enough health to pay ability costs without turning every cast into a lethal risk.

Manuals, time, and skill points are separate gates

A level and available skill points do not guarantee immediate access to every upgrade. Sword and witchcraft techniques require the appropriate knowledge source; vampiric tiers require corruption. Learning or improving an ability can also consume narrative time. Check all four questions before committing: do you meet the level or corruption condition, own the manual, have enough points, and accept the time cost?

That final cost matters because the story gives Coen 30 in-game days. Collect manuals while exploring, which does not continuously consume time, then learn several deliberately chosen upgrades instead of paying for every available option.

Ultimates and respec planning

Method's launch-version guide places three ultimate choices at the bottom of each tree and reports a 35-point cost, with only one ultimate active per tree. It also reports that medic NPCs can reset ordinary talents and that ultimate choices can be swapped more freely. These are third-party tested interface details and should be rechecked after balance patches.

A practical first build uses Swordmastery to stay functional at all times, then favors either Witchcraft or Vampirism according to when you prefer tackling difficult content. For execution, continue with the combat guide. For scheduling upgrades, see the time-system guide.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many skill trees are in The Blood of Dawnwalker?

There are three main paths: Swordmastery, Witchcraft, and Vampirism.

Can skill points earned during the day buy vampire abilities?

Yes. Bandai Namco confirms one shared experience bar and one shared skill-point currency across all three paths.
